Japanese Melonpan
15 ingredients
17 steps
Ingredients
- 2 7/16 tablespoons butter
- 5 1/4 tablespoons sugar
- 1 egg
- 1 cup white flour
- 1 lemon only the juice
- 1 lemon only the zest
- 2 cups white flour
- 1 tablespoon powdered milk
- 5 1/4 tablespoons sugar
- 1/8 tablespoon salt
- 1 1/4 teaspoons yeast
- 2 tablespoons egg yolk
- 1 tablespoon egg white
- 6 3/4 tablespoons water
- 1 3/4 tablespoons butter melted at room temperature
Directions
-
1Mix butter and sugar in a large bowl.
-
2Add the egg and slowly add the 120 grams white flour while stirring the mixture.
-
3Add the lemon juice and lemon zest, and mix until you obtain dough.
-
4Remove the dough from the bowl and cover it completely with plastic wrap. Let it sit in the refrigerator for 3 to 4 hours.
-
5Mix the white flour, milk, sugar, salt, and yeast in a large bowl.
-
6Add the egg white, egg yolk, water, and mix until the dough has a soft texture.
-
7Place the dough in the counter-top and knead.
-
8Flatten the dough, add butter, and keep kneading it for 10 minutes.
-
9Form a dough ball and cover it with plastic film. Let it sit in a warm place until it doubles its size. This takes from 1 to 2 hours.
-
10Sprinkle the counter-top with flour and place the dough ball there. Roll it until it stretches and separate it in portions about 35 grams each.
-
11Shape each portion into balls, sprinkle white flour over a cooking tray, place the portions on the tray, and cover the tray with plastic film. Let them sit for 20 minutes in a warm place.
-
12Take the frosting dough from the fridge and place it on the counter-top. Roll it until it stretches and separate it in circle-shaped portions about 8 centimeters wide.
-
13Sprinkle white flour on another cooking tray, place the dough circles on the tray, and cover the tray with plastic film. Let them sit for 15 minutes at room temperature while you preheat the oven at 180 C.
-
14Remove the plastic wrap from both trays.
-
15Sprinkle with water the dough balls and cover them with the dough circles on top.
-
16Sprinkle each Melonpan with sugar, place them on a greased cooking tray, and bake for 12 to 15 minutes at 180 C.
-
17Remove them from the oven, let them cool off completely, and serve.
